Applications

Tin nanopowder (<100 nm) is widely utilized in research focused on:

  • Electronics Manufacturing: Its excellent conductivity makes it ideal for creating soldering materials and conductive inks, enhancing the performance and reliability of electronic devices.
  • Energy Storage: Used in the development of advanced battery technologies, tin nanopowder improves the efficiency and capacity of lithium-ion batteries, offering longer-lasting power solutions.
  • Coatings and Paints: The antimicrobial properties of tin nanopowder are leveraged in protective coatings, which help prevent corrosion and extend the lifespan of metal surfaces.
  • Biomedical Applications: Its biocompatibility allows for the use of tin nanopowder in drug delivery systems and medical implants, improving patient outcomes through targeted therapies.
  • Environmental Remediation: Tin nanopowder is effective in removing heavy metals from wastewater, providing a sustainable solution for industries looking to minimize their environmental impact.
